选择题:下面程序段的时间复杂度为()。voidsum(intn)//n为正整数{intp=1,sum=0,i;for(i=1;i 题目分类:中国大学MOOC慕课 题目类型:选择题 查看权限:VIP 题目内容: 下面程序段的时间复杂度为()。voidsum(intn)//n为正整数{intp=1,sum=0,i;for(i=1;i=n;i++){p*=i;sum+=p;}} A.O()B.O(n)C.O(1)D.O(n^2) 参考答案:
插入和删除操作是数据结构中最基本的两种操作,所以这两种操作在数组中也经常使用。 插入和删除操作是数据结构中最基本的两种操作,所以这两种操作在数组中也经常使用。这是一个关于操作 数据结构的相关问题,下面我们来看 分类:中国大学MOOC慕课 题型:选择题 查看答案
若用一个大小为6的数组来实现循环队列,且当前rear和front的值分别为3和1,当从队列中删除一个元素再加入两个元素后 若用一个大小为6的数组来实现循环队列,且当前rear和front的值分别为3和1,当从队列中删除一个元素再加入两个元素后,rear和front的值为()。这是一个关于元素 数据结构 队列的相关问题,下面我们来看 分类:中国大学MOOC慕课 题型:选择题 查看答案
一个栈的输入序列为1,2,3,…,n,若输出序列的第一个元素是i,则输出第j(1=j=i)个元素是()。 一个栈的输入序列为1,2,3,…,n,若输出序列的第一个元素是i,则输出第j(1=j=i)个元素是()。这是一个关于元素 数据结构 序列的相关问题,下面我们来看 分类:中国大学MOOC慕课 题型:选择题 查看答案
对于一个具有n个结点的单链表,在已知的结点*p后插入一个新结点的时间复杂度和在给定值为x的结点后插入一个新结点的时间复杂 对于一个具有n个结点的单链表,在已知的结点*p后插入一个新结点的时间复杂度和在给定值为x的结点后插入一个新结点的时间复杂度分别为()。这是一个关于结点 数据结构 复杂度的相关问题,下面我们来看 分类:中国大学MOOC慕课 题型:选择题 查看答案